Why meteoroids traveling close to the Earth get attracted towards it?

A

Due to rotation of Earth

B

Due to gravitational pull of Earth

C

Due to revolution of Earth

D

Due to the tilted axis of Earth

Text Solution

AI Generated Solution

The correct Answer is:
### Step-by-Step Solution: 1. **Understanding Meteoroids**: Meteoroids are small rocky or metallic bodies in outer space. They can originate from asteroids or comets and usually travel in orbits around the sun. 2. **Movement of Meteoroids**: When meteoroids leave their original orbit (for example, from the asteroid belt) and start traveling towards the sun, they can also come close to Earth. 3. **Gravitational Force**: The reason meteoroids get attracted towards Earth is due to the gravitational force. Every object with mass exerts a gravitational pull on other objects. 4. **Earth's Gravitational Pull**: As a meteoroid approaches Earth, the gravitational pull of Earth becomes stronger on it. This force pulls the meteoroid towards the Earth. 5. **Terminology**: When a meteoroid enters the Earth's atmosphere and starts to burn up due to friction with the air, it is referred to as a "meteor." If it survives the journey through the atmosphere and lands on the Earth's surface, it is called a "meteorite." 6. **Conclusion**: Therefore, the attraction of meteoroids towards Earth is primarily due to the gravitational force exerted by Earth. ### Final Answer: Meteoroids traveling close to the Earth get attracted towards it due to the gravitational pull of the Earth. ---
